/**
* Tries to delete a {@link File} refering to a single {@link File#isFile() "file"} (not a {@literal directory})
* in the file system.
*
* @param file {@link File} to delete.
* @return a boolean value indicating whether the given {@link File} was successfully deleted.
* @see #tryDelete(File, int, long)
* @see java.io.File
*/
protected boolean tryDelete(File file) {
return tryDelete(file, DEFAULT_DELETE_ATTEMPTS, DEFAULT_DELETE_TIMED_WAIT_INTERVAL);
}
/**
* Tries to delete a {@link File} refering to a single {@link File#isFile() "file"} (not a {@literal directory})
* in the file system.
*
* @param file {@link File} to delete.
* @param attempts {@link Integer} indicating the number of attemps to try and delete the {@link File}.
* @param waitDurationBetweenAttempts {@link Long} indicating the number of milliseconds to wait
* between delete attempts.
* @return a boolean value indicating whether the given {@link File} was successfully deleted.
* @see #tryDelete(File, int, long)
* @see java.io.File
*/
@SuppressWarnings("all")
protected boolean tryDelete(File file, int attempts, long waitDurationBetweenAttempts) {
if (FileSystemUtils.isFile(file)) {
long interval = waitDurationBetweenAttempts;
long duration = attempts * interval;
return ThreadUtils.timedWait(duration, interval, file::delete);
}
return false;
}
